Undo/redo in the Linkspan diagram editor is command-based: every edit pushes a reversible command onto the history stack, capped at 200 entries. Redo clears on any new edit. Multi-select operations are batched as one command. Known gap: connector re-routing isn't yet undoable; fix is tracked. Don't bypass the command layer when adding features. For stack internals questions, contact the editor core team.

alerts address for kajog-tadup: druox@plorvanet.internal

Leadership Review Briefing — Loyalty Overhaul

Quick heads-up before Thursday: the revamp of the Kestrel Points scheme is tracking well. Redemption rates at our Bramleigh stores doubled after the tier simplification, and the app team at Orvend says the new wallet feature ships next month. One sensitive item on commercial direction follows below.

board note of fafog-yahap: Project Rusdor slips by a full year because of the audit delay.

TURN-208: Gatevale turnstile counters at the Merrow Field pilot double-count when a rotation reverses mid-cycle. Attendance totals drift roughly 2% high per event. The debounce window fix is implemented, reviewed by Ilsa, and soak-tested across two simulated match days without drift. Ready for your cut; the candidate build is identified below.

trace token, tagag-tafog: htk6_5ed18c

Subject: Project Lanternway — Revised Timeline

Team,

As you know, Lanternway's internal rollout has slipped by six weeks due to integration issues between the quoting module and the Veralta billing layer. Corin's group has isolated the defect and expects a stable build by mid-month. Please hold off on customer-facing commitments until then, and route all timeline questions to me directly. For context, I am sharing the confidential planning note below.

internal memo for hahif-hahaf: Headcount on the Zorwyn team goes from 9 to 100 by the end of October. Gross margin on Zorwyn came in at 5 percent against a plan of 10 percent.